Goal

Full life cycle management for python apps and libs. Create python boilerplate, develop, update boilerplate and publish.

  • Single point of truth for project parameters

State

The repository contains a WIP MVP to evaliuate different technologies, workflows and user interface. It's quick and dirty.

Not suited for production work. Major version zero (0.y.z) is for initial development. Anything may change at any time. The public API should not be considered stable.

Opinionated

The software is based on decisions regarding project structure and used libraries.

Current decisions (effecting projects managed with cpa, not just cpa's developemt itself):

  • py.test to run tests
  • git for version control
  • type annotations are good
  • gitlab ci integration

In evaluation:

  • pipenv vs poetry
  • mypy vs pytype

Some of them might end up being configurable, some might never be configurable. Keeping CPA simple might take priority.

Usage

Commands:
  create   create new project
  dist     create distributables
  publish  publish to pypi
  test     run tests
  update   update current project
